JOB SUMMARY:
Assembly, modification, and validation testing of new and existing industrial electrical equipment product designs.
RESPONSIBILITY:
- Perform assembly, modification, and validation testing on new products being developed as well as new parts or modifications for existing products.
- Perform third party certification testing on new products or modifications of existing products.
- Generate reports documenting testing results.
- Assist with assembly and testing of production units as needed.
TRAVEL:
Occasional travel is required.
This position is hourly pay with overtime possibility.
EDUCATION/CERTIFICATION REQUIRED:
Two-year technical degree in an electrical/electronic field or related military training.
S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E:
- 0-3 years of experience in testing, commissioning, or repair of industrial electronics, control gear, and/or switchgear.
- Proficient in reading elect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and mechanical and electrical assembly drawing.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office applications
- Proficient in the use of tools and test equipment: Hand tools, power tools, oscilloscopes, multi-meters, power supplies, waveform generators, data loggers, insulation test equipment, etc.
- Must be familiar working with AC and DC voltages.
- Experience with medium voltage equipment is a plus.
